Overview of the Intel Arc A380
The Intel Arc A380 is a mid-range graphics card designed to deliver solid gaming performance and support for modern graphics technologies. It is built on Intel’s latest Xe-HPG architecture, offering features such as hardware-accelerated ray tracing, AI-based image enhancement, and efficient power consumption. Its compatibility with various systems makes it a popular choice for budget-conscious gamers and content creators.

What to Consider When Choosing an Intel Arc A380
- Cooling and Design: Ensure the card has an effective cooling system to prevent overheating during intensive use.
- Factory Overclocking: Overclocked models can offer better performance but may generate more heat and noise.
- Connectivity: Check for the types and number of display outputs to support your monitor setup.
- Price and Warranty: Compare prices across brands and consider warranty options for peace of mind.
